CK&S 819 (EMD NW2 ex-IHB)

The Carthage, Knightstown and Shirley Railroad, now defunct, carried riders on an hour-long ride on rails once owned by the Big Four railroad company near Knightstown, Ind., a town about 30 miles from Indianapolis. Special events included a Mother's Day trip, Train Robbery adventures as well as Pumpkin Patch Runs in October. The CK&S; also provided rides for festival attendees when Knightstown celebrates Jubilee Days in June and a citywide festival in September. In addition to this NW2, the roster also had two GE 45-tonners, No. 215 and 468.
